Softmax function formula It converts a vector of raw scores (logits) into a probability distribution over classes. In each node in the final (or The SoftMax® Pro Data Acquisition and Analysis Software Formula Reference Guide identifies and enumerates the details about formulas, accessors, and functions that you can use to create powerful data analysis templates for Protocol files in order to completely automate the analysis and results reporting for your plate reads. 1. Before Attention mechanism, translation relies on reading a full sentence and compressing all information Found. The softmax function is the gradient of the log-sum-exp function where is Mar 5, 2025 · Definition: A function that converts a vector of logits into probabilities (values between 0 and 1) that sum to 1 The Softmax Activation Function is like a probability maker in machine learning Sep 12, 2024 · The softmax function 2024-09-12 — 2024-09-15 Wherein real-valued vectors are mapped to simplex weights by exponentiation and normalization, the entropy of the resulting categorical distribution is derived, and its gradient is shown to be the probability vector minus one. The softmax gives at least a minimal amount of probability to all elements in the output vector, and so is nicely differentiable. Its primary purpose is to transform a vector of real numbers into a probability distribution, enabling us to make informed decisions based on the output probabilities. But, here, we are going to implement it in the NumPy library because we know that NumPy is one of the efficient and powerful libraries. This function serves a pivotal role in converting raw model outputs, often referred to as logits, into meaningful probabilities. Aug 25, 2025 · Softmax differs from other popular activation functions in that it takes into account the entire layer and scales outputs so they sum to a value of 1. It outputs probabilities for each class, unlike the sigmoid Sep 5, 2024 · The softmax function is an essential mathematical concept used in machine learning, particularly in neural networks, to convert a vector of raw scores into a probability distribution such that the sum of all probabilities equals one. Jan 30, 2018 · We will help you understand the Softmax function in a beginner friendly manner by showing you exactly how it works — by coding your very own Softmax function in python. Feb 10, 2024 · SoftMax is a crucial activation function in the final layer of Convolutional Neural Networks (CNNs) for several reasons: Probability Distribution: SoftMax converts the raw output scores or logits generated by the last layer of a neural network into a probability distribution. It is fundamental for multi-class classification in neural networks. Its key role is to transform the network's final scores into a meaningful probability distribution over multiple, mutually Feb 28, 2025 · The softmax function is an activation function often used as an output function in the last layer of a neural network. The softmax function is typically applied to the raw attention scores obtained from the dot product of query and key vectors in the self-attention mechanism. e. It consists of two main parts for each number in the list: the top part (numerator) and the bottom part (denominator). 4. exp(y)) May 28, 2022 · Softmax activation function is used widely in various machine learning and deep learning applications. Graph functions, plot points, visualize algebraic equations, add sliders, animate graphs, and more. May 10, 2023 · Softmax is a generalization of logistic regression that can be used for multi-class classification, and its formula is very similar to the sigmoid function which is used for logistic regression. Rescales them so that the elements of the n-dimensional output Tensor lie in the range [0,1] and sum to 1. Sep 30, 2020 · Softmax is a function placed at the end of deep learning network to convert logits into classification probabilities. Jun 2, 2021 · I'm recently working on CNN and I want to know what is the function of temperature in the softmax formula? and why should we use high temperatures to see a softer norm in probability distribution? This MATLAB function takes a S-by-Q matrix of net input (column) vectors, N, and returns the S-by-Q matrix, A, of the softmax competitive function applied to each column of N. Note that the Jan 29, 2025 · Here, the denominator of the softmax function also called as normalization factor is computed by summing up the exponential of all the elements of a particular row of the matrix S, or in other words, the sum of the exponential of all the elements in the input sequence. The SoftMax® Pro Software Formula Reference Guide identifies and enumerates all the details about formulas, accessors, and functions that you can use to create powerful data analysis templates, that when saved as Protocol files, can completely automate the analysis and results reporting for all your microplate reads. . Softmax and Cross-Entropy Loss Since the softmax function and the corresponding cross-entropy loss are so common, it is worth understanding a bit better how they are computed. pfs auxb uarcjr oixdi mozwlj bidfo mku mlw wpnl raci dfyba cqibtpg wpiz gjtwy iczyq